Experienced SEN Teaching Assistant – Special Educational Needs School in Tonbridge

Full‑time position attracting an outline wage of £93 per day. Hours are Monday to Friday, 8:30 a.m. to 3:30 p.m., and the role is initially ad‑hoc with potential to become long‑term.

The Role

  • Support pupils on a 1:1 or small‑group basis with severe learning difficulties (SLD), profound and multiple learning difficulties (PMLD), complex learning difficulties, autism spectrum condition (ASC), and sensory impairments.
  • Assist with personalised learning programmes tailored to each pupil’s Education, Health and Care Plan (EHCP), focusing on communication, independence and life skills.
  • Provide personal care where required, ensuring dignity and respect at all times.
  • Use a calm, patient, and nurturing approach to support pupils who may have communication difficulties or sensory needs.
  • Work collaboratively with teachers, therapists and support staff to create an inclusive and engaging learning environment.
  • Act as a positive role model who genuinely wants to make a difference.
  • Take initiative in the classroom and build meaningful, trusting relationships with pupils and their families.

Requirements

  • Prior experience as a Teaching Assistant, Learning Support Assistant, Care Support Worker, or within a specialist SEN setting.
  • Experience supporting children or young people with SLD, PMLD, autism or complex needs is advantageous.
  • Demonstrated patience, emotional resilience, adaptability and a proactive attitude.
  • Willingness to assist with personal care and medical needs where necessary.
  • Right to work in the UK and willingness to obtain an enhanced DBS (child‑only) via the update service or to obtain a new DBS, with reimbursement after 20 days of work.
  • If you have been outside the UK for six months or more in the last five years, you must obtain an overseas police check.
